Based on a conventional authorization price of 20%, a method to all providing pairs over a year would certainly be required to obtain a consenting example of 280 couples. An approximated 10% were likely to be declared ineligible adhering to the first session, generating approximately 252 eligible couples at baseline. Based on historic RAV data, we prepared for a 20% attrition price by 3 month follow-up (n = 201 couples) and a further 30% by twelve month follow-up, generating a final assessment sample of 141 couples.
Comparable numbers were expected for the partnership education and learning sample. To determine just how the recognized variables (gender, age, marital standing, number of counselling sessions participated in, length of partnership, length of problems in partnership, factors for going to couple counselling) affect our result variables (pair fulfillment, commitment, clinical depression) at the two follow-ups, and in contrasting the baseline data in between teams, a generalized linear unrealized and blended design (GLLAMM) is planned [51,60]
Standard GLMs fall short when the gathered data are not separately and identically distributed (i.i.d.), as in the situation of all longitudinal and gathered studies, consisting of those investigating couples. In this study, the outcomes are gauged repeatedly at pre-test, 3-month and 1-year follow-up. Because of this, the data exhibit an ordered structure, i.e., the duplicated observations are nested within people, and the people are embedded within pairs.
